The Beauty Of Etched Aluminum: A Versatile And Modern Material

When it comes to modern design and architecture, materials play a crucial role in creating a unique and stylish aesthetic. One material that has been gaining popularity in recent years is etched aluminum. Known for its versatility, durability, and sleek appearance, etched aluminum is a versatile material that can be used in a wide range of applications.

etched aluminum is created through a process called chemical etching, which involves using a combination of chemicals to remove material and create a desired pattern or design on the surface of the metal. This process allows for intricate and precise detailing that is not possible with traditional cutting or shaping methods. The result is a stunning, textured surface that can add depth and visual interest to any project.

One of the key advantages of etched aluminum is its durability. The chemical etching process creates a surface that is resistant to scratches, fading, and corrosion, making it an ideal material for outdoor use. This makes etched aluminum a popular choice for architectural elements such as facades, cladding, and signage, as well as for decorative accents and custom furniture pieces.

One of the most common uses for etched aluminum is in architectural applications. The material is often used to create decorative cladding for buildings, adding a modern and sophisticated touch to any structure. etched aluminum can be combined with other materials such as glass, stone, or wood to create striking contrasts and unique design features.

etched aluminum is also a popular choice for signage and wayfinding systems. The material can be etched with logos, text, or graphics to create eye-catching displays that are both functional and aesthetically pleasing. Whether you are looking to enhance the branding of a commercial space or create a striking entrance feature for a residential property, etched aluminum offers a durable and stylish solution.

In interior design, etched aluminum can be used in a variety of ways to add a touch of modern elegance to any space. From custom furniture pieces to decorative wall panels, the material can be incorporated into a wide range of applications. Etched aluminum can also be used to create unique lighting fixtures, screens, and room dividers that add visual interest and sophistication to any room.
